使用 AmazonMQ 的 rabbitmqadmin

问题描述

我已经在 AmazonMQ 中配置了一个 RabbitMQ 代理,作为我们自己的 RabbitMQ 的可能替代方案,该代理托管在我们的 Kubernetes 集群上。 AmazonMQ 为我提供了两个端点,一个用于 Web 控制台,另一个用于 AMQP。

在我们现有的架构中,我们使用 rabbitmqadmin 命令行工具通过 json 文件导入配置。

尝试导入json文件时,连接超时


During handling of the above exception,another exception occurred:

Traceback (most recent call last):
  File "rabbitmqadmin",line 1184,in <module>
    main()
  File "rabbitmqadmin",line 523,in main
    method()
  File "rabbitmqadmin",line 715,in invoke_import
    self.post(uri,deFinitions)
  File "rabbitmqadmin",line 558,in post
    return self.http("POST","%s/api%s" % (self.options.path_prefix,path),body)
  File "rabbitmqadmin",line 609,in http
    conn.request(method,path,body,headers)
  File "C:\Program Files (x86)\python37-32\lib\http\client.py",line 1244,in request
    self._send_request(method,url,headers,encode_chunked)
  File "C:\Program Files (x86)\python37-32\lib\http\client.py",line 1290,in _send_request
    self.endheaders(body,encode_chunked=encode_chunked)
  File "C:\Program Files (x86)\python37-32\lib\http\client.py",line 1239,in endheaders
    self._send_output(message_body,line 1026,in _send_output
    self.send(msg)
  File "C:\Program Files (x86)\python37-32\lib\http\client.py",line 966,in send
    self.connect()
  File "C:\Program Files (x86)\python37-32\lib\http\client.py",line 938,in connect
    (self.host,self.port),self.timeout,self.source_address)
  File "C:\Program Files (x86)\python37-32\lib\socket.py",line 716,in create_connection
    sock.connect(sa)```

I can't see any security groups attached the broker. How can I connect to an AmazonMQ RabbitMQ broker using rabbitmqadmin?

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)